Different types of moves are best handled by different movers. The first step in picking a moving company is determining whether a national or local company will work best for your needs. Movers can also be split into full-service and self-service movers. A full-service moving company provides packing and loading services, which can be great if you're someone who hates packing boxes. Self-service movers provide a truck and a driver, but you'll be expected to have everything packed when they get there.
Next, you can check which moving companies near you meet the licensing requirements for movers in Florida. You can also browse online reviews and take a look at the company's rating on the BBB. All of the companies on our list of the best movers in St. Augustine Shores are well-reviewed and chosen by our team of experts.
Once you've narrowed your list down to a few companies, you can start getting estimates from them. We recommend talking to at least one or two of the companies on our list above. When you're speaking with a moving company, be sure that you explain all the services you'll need. You should also verify that the estimate you're given is a "binding estimate." Otherwise, it may be subject to change.

You should choose a local mover if you would prefer a more personal experience. Local movers are more familiar with the area and can provide more tailored services. However, national movers usually have more resources, better insurance, and a wider variety of services.
The ideal time to book your move is four to six weeks in advance. If you book later, you may pay more and have a harder time finding available movers.
